When prices surge across various sectors of the economy, you’ll start hearing analysts talk about inflation. Inflation is the devaluation of currency over time, meaning as goods and services become more expensive, the buying power of your money decreases. People will often first notice inflation by realizing that something they buy regularly is more expensive than usual—maybe your grocery store or gas pump receipt is higher than expected. In his podcast addressing the markets today, Louis Navellier offered the following commentary. Alarming CPIOn Thursday, the Labor Department announced that its Consumer Price Index (CPI) rose 0.4% in September and 8.2% in the past 12 months. The core CPI, excluding food and energy, rose 0.6% in September and 6.6% in the past 12 months. U.K. inflation in February reached an annual 6.2%, the highest since March 1992, coming from a previous 30-year record of 5.5% recorded in January. Food and energy prices are playing a major role amid Russia’s invasion of Ukraine. U.K. Inflation On A HighAs reported by CNBC, inflation in the U.K. reached a fresh record in February and beat the 5.9% estimate by experts. Consumer Price Index (CPI) inflation jumped 0.8% from January and above a 0.6% expectation —the biggest monthly increase since March 2009. Inflation in the U.K. reached 4.2% in October, its highest level in nearly 10 years, due to the rise in fuel and energy prices. According to the Office for National Statistics (ONS), the consumer price index (CPI) had increased by 3.1% the previous month.
